In the original trilogy of games, the city view screen was the only way to change the default view of the game. The new game engine for Civilization IV introduced a fresh aspect to gameplay. Meanwhile, you can declare state religions, which offer bonuses in happiness, production, and other aspects of the game. This adds a new dimension to the game, with these faiths spread by missionary units and trade routes. Seven religions are featured in the game: Buddhism, Christianity, Confucianism, Hinduism, Islam, Judaism, and Taoism. You'll also find Civilization III on GOG and Amazon. This will ensure that the game installs and runs without any issues. The simplest is to buy it from Steam for just $5. You have three options for playing Civilization III today. Space Race - Be the first to launch a completed Spaceship to Alpha Centauri.Diplomatic - You are elected head of the United Nations.Cultural - Successful assimilation of other civilizations.Domination - You control two-thirds of the planet.Conquest - Yours is the last civilization standing.With the introduction of culture, Civilization III has five victory conditions: Players can use Great Leaders to create an army, in which several units can be grouped together. These can appear when an elite unit wins a battle, although it depends on chance. These are essentially high-bonus city improvements.Ĭombat also evolved in Civilization III, notably with the introduction of Great Leaders. This is an open-source clone of Civilization which is largely based on Civilization II.Ĭivilization III also introduced Small Wonders - sites like Wall Street or The Pentagon - which are not impervious to destruction during conquest like full Wonders. However for large quantities of printing, screens can be coated with a photo-sensitive emulsion and designs developed onto the screen allowing for more complex and detailed design to be printed. Multiple stencils can be used to create complex and colourful designs and stencils are still used today. Paper or plastic hand cut stencils are placed on top of the fabric or paper, then the screen is placed on top of the stencil inks are pushed through the screen where the substrate is exposed the inks will dye and colour the surface, where the substrate is covered up by the stencil, the original colour of the fabric or paper will remain. Inks are pressed through a fine mesh screen using a squeegee, over stretched fabric or secured paper laid down onto a flat surface. Famous works include Whaam!, Hopeless, Haystacks, and Drowning Girl. He often combined several printing techniques into his work using screen print, lithograph and wood-cut blocks to reproduce his most popular paintings and express his ideas. Inspired by comic strips, his large canvases echoed the comic strip’s compositional narratives with bold outlines, vivid palettes and Ben-Day dots. Roy Lichtenstein’s work also played an important role in introducing screen printing as a relevant and significant Fine Art technique during the 1960s. Particularly during the 1960s when he created his famous Marilyn Diptych 1962, Triple Elvis 1963 and Campbell’s Soup Cans 1962. Screen printing was a popular technique used by Andy Warhol and other POP artists during the 20th century. It has been used for centuries, and within the last 100 years in both the commercial industries printed fabrics, textiles, clothing, and interior fabrics and in the Fine Art sector for Posters, Fine Art Canvases, contemporary Textile Artwork. This was originally an ancient and traditional Chinese method of printing using silk threads to create the finely woven mesh fabric. Inks are pushed through the mesh and onto the substrate leaving a pattern or design made by a stencil. Screen printing is a method of printing images or patterns onto fabric, paper or canvas using a wooden or metal screen with an ultra fine mesh fabric stretched over the top. Rheumatoid arthritis is an autoimmune condition that causes joint pain, stiffness and swelling leading to impaired hand function and difficulty with daily activities. He quit his day job and brought Broussard on. By 1990, he was publishing and marketing titles created by others. When Miller was in his twenties, he invented the shareware model of selling games and formed his company, Apogee (which started going by 3D Realms in 1994): He'd break a game into chunks, release it for free on BBSes, get people addicted, and then charge them for the remaining parts. They would hang out in the computer lab, programming clunky 2-D and text-adventure games. As one patient fan pointed out, when development on Duke Nukem Forever started, most computers were still using Windows 95, Pixar had made only one movie - Toy Story - and Xbox did not yet exist.īroussard and Miller met in the late '70s in Dallas, during Miller's senior year of high school. But the Duke Nukem Forever team worked for 12 years straight. Normally, videogames take two to four years to build five years is considered worryingly long. Screenshots and video snippets would leak out every few years, each time whipping fans into a lather - and each time, the game would recede from view. The team quickly began work on that sequel, Duke Nukem Forever, and it became one of the most hotly anticipated games of all time. Featuring a swaggering, steroidal, wisecracking hero, Duke Nukem 3D became one of the top-selling videogames ever, making its creators very wealthy and leaving fans absolutely delirious for a sequel. It's the insignia of Duke Nukem 3D, a computer game that revolutionized shoot-'em-up virtual violence in 1996. To videogame fans, that logo is instantly recognizable.
